A Writ Of Garnishment Served On A Garnishee Holding Property Of The Judgment Debtor Requires The Garnishee To Answer The Writ And Make An Accounting To The Court.
Tennessee essentially follows federal law for determining the maximum amount garnished. For example, if the employee has weekly disposable wages of $425, 25 percent of this amount would be $106.25. If you make $500 per week after all taxes and allowable deductions, 25% of your disposable earnings is $125 ($500 ×.25 = $125).
